How to Calculate X Score

Calculating the X score involves several steps. First, you need to gather the necessary data points. Then, you apply the X score formula to these data points. The formula used in this calculator is as follows:

X Score = (Σ(xi - μ)²) / N

Where:

  • Σ(xi - μ)² is the sum of squared deviations from the mean
  • μ is the mean of the data points
  • N is the number of data points

This formula calculates the average of the squared differences from the mean, providing a measure of the variability in the data set.

Step-by-Step Calculation

  1. Collect your data points and calculate the mean (μ).
  2. For each data point, subtract the mean and square the result.
  3. Sum all the squared deviations.
  4. Divide the sum by the number of data points (N).

Using this method, you can accurately calculate the X score for any data set.

Example Calculation

Let's say you have the following data points: 2, 4, 6, 8, 10.

  1. Calculate the mean: (2 + 4 + 6 + 8 + 10) / 5 = 6
  2. Calculate squared deviations: (2-6)² = 16, (4-6)² = 4, (6-6)² = 0, (8-6)² = 4, (10-6)² = 16
  3. Sum of squared deviations: 16 + 4 + 0 + 4 + 16 = 40
  4. X Score: 40 / 5 = 8
